Thinking about it because the LOTW upload is manual and therefore done sometime after the QSO is logged, whereas the QRZ upload is done at the same instant that the QSO is logged then at the time of the QRZ upload nothing has yet happened re LOTW

On the basis of the above it is clear that the status of LOTW for that QSO could not be anything other that you are getting.

If however you disabled the auto upload to QRZ and then after having uploaded to LOTW manually went and uploaded to QRZ manually I am sure that the result would be what you require

I have just tried exactly what I described in paragraph 3 above and it all worked as expected.
